Job description:7+ years of experience as a scrum master or in a similar role. - Guides and coaches the Scrum Team on how to use Agile practices and principles to deliver high quality products and services to our customers. - Working knowledge of agile methodology, techniques, and frameworks, such as Scrum or Kanban, to deliver solutions. - Excellent knowledge of Scrum techniques and artifacts (such as the definition of done, user stories, automated testing, backlog refinement). - Gets team to a high performing level by recognizing areas of strength and improvement and employing appropriate coaching and development techniques. - Responsible for ensuring Scrum is understood and the team adheres to Scrum theory, practice, and guidelines. - Coaches the Scrum team in self-organization, cross-functional skillset, domain knowledge and communicates effectively, both internally and externally working within the Scrum team. - Works with Scrum Team, as well as internal and external stakeholders, to influence and drive decision making and support organizational project or product teams. - Resolves team impediments with other Scrum Masters to increase the effectiveness of the application of Scrum in the organization. - Works with Agile coaches and other Scrum Masters to grow within the role. - Contributes to the advancement and improvement of Agile practices within the organization. - Facilitates and supports all scrum events: Sprint Planning, Daily Scrum, Sprint Review, and Sprint Retrospective. - Acts as a leader who coaches and supports Agile teams assigned to mainly Business as Usual (BAU) work and to a lesser degree, important department initiatives and applicable portions of corporate projects and initiatives.
